EPR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

323 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in EPR Properties (EPR)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$2.8B — down 2.7% from $2.88B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 58 funds opened new EPR positions and 40 closed out — a net gain of 18 holders — while 106 added to existing stakes and 96 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Centersquare Investment Management, adding an estimated $25.7M. The largest seller was Nut Tree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$19.8M sold.
